Abstract
A new method for testing necked specimens for thermal fatigue is descr ibed and used to determine the dependence of the growth rate of therma l fatigue microcracks on the range of the coefficient of stress intens ity, the effect of properties of the manufacturing of coatings, their composition, and the composition of the base metal on the conditions f or initiation and development of thermal fatigue cracks, as well as th e effect of the oriented structure in cast high-temperature alloys on the conditions of their fracture due to thermal fatigue.
